Added illuminated visors 2014 STX

My 2014 STX came with plane jane visors. Driver side no mirror, Passenger side mirror but no illumination

I ordered two visors from my local Ford dealer
CL3Z.1504105.EC $43.18 list price
CL3Z.1504104.DC $38.87 list price

Matching L&R Grey with mirror with illumination

I was happy to find out my truck was prewired for it.

drivers side comparison


passenger side harness is inside the headliner above the visor, parallel to the windshield

drivers side is parallel to the door opening



I removed the plastic clip out of the roof to show how the harness is supposed to be routed. You'll notice a slight valley cut out in the white clip to allow the harness to pass through the side without getting pinched

You should have got the one with the garage door opener built in, they just need power and ground to operate. They are required to not integrate them into the can bus so they are basically plug n play. It's a pretty common swap on the mark 3 focus' the 2012 had it factory installed then it was dropped for 13 and 14 so everyone without it just buys a 2012 visor and swaps it in. On the focus model the power and ground are spliced into the same wires that power the mirror inside the visor so they use the same plug under the headliner.
